Abstract and keywords
Abstract (English):
The concept of a defect report is considered, and the stages of its life cycle are determined

Keywords:
testing, defect report, life cycle of defect report, tools
Text
Publication text (PDF): Read Download

Отчёт о дефекте (defect report) – документ, описывающий и приоритизирующий обнаруженный дефект, а также содействующий его устранению. Как следует из самого определения, отчёт о дефекте пишется со следующими основными целями:

  • предоставить информацию о проблеме – уведомить проектную команду и иных заинтересованных лиц о наличии проблемы, описать суть проблемы;
  • приоритизировать проблему – определить степень опасности проблемы для проекта и желаемые сроки её устранения;
  • содействовать устранению проблемы – качественный отчёт о дефекте также может содержать анализ причин возникновения проблемы и рекомендации по исправлению ситуации.

Отчёт о дефекте проходит определённые стадии жизненного цикла, которые схематично можно показать так (рисунок 1):

  • обнаружен (submitted) – начальное состояние отчёта (иногда называется «Новый» (new)), в котором он находится сразу после создания. Некоторые средства также позволяют сначала создавать черновик (draft) и лишь потом публиковать отчёт;
  • назначен (assigned) – в это состояние отчёт переходит с момента, когда кто-то из проектной команды назначается ответственным за исправление дефекта;
  • исправлен (fixed) – в это состояние отчёт переводит ответственный за исправление дефекта член команды после выполнения соответствующих действий по исправлению;
  • проверен (verified) – в это состояние отчёт переводит тестировщик, удостоверившийся, что дефект на самом деле был устранён;
  • закрыт (closed) – состояние отчёта, означающее, что по данному дефектуне планируется никаких дальнейших действий. Здесь есть некоторые расхождения в жизненном цикле, принятом в разных инструментальных средствах управления отчётами о дефектах;
  • открыт заново (reopened) – в это состояние (как правило, из состояния «Исправлен») отчёт переводит тестировщик, удостоверившийся, что дефект по-прежнему воспроизводится на билде, в котором он уже должен быть исправлен;
  • рекомендован к отклонению (to be declined) – отчёт о дефекте может быть переведён из множества других состояний с целью вынести на рассмотрение вопрос об отклонении отчёта по той или иной причине. Если рекомендация является обоснованной, отчёт переводится в состояние «Отклонён»;
  • отклонён (declined) – в это состояние отчёт переводится в случаях, подробно описанных в пункте «Закрыт», если средство управления отчётами о дефектах предполагает использование этого состояния вместо состояния «Закрыт» для тех или иных резолюций по отчёту;
  • отложен (deferred) – в это состояние отчёт переводится в случае, если исправление дефекта в ближайшее время является нерациональным или не представляется возможным, однако есть основания полагать, что в обозримом будущем ситуация исправится (выйдет новая версия библиотеки, изменятся требования заказчика и т.д.).

Рисунок 1 – Стадии жизненного цикла отчёта о дефекте

Важно помнить, что в различных инструментальных средствах стадии жизненного цикла отчета о дефекте могут отличаться.

References

1. Aleksandrova E. G. Zhiznennyy cikl i osnovnye principy testiro-vaniya / E. G. Aleksandrova, N. N. Dobrynina. – Tekst : neposredstvennyy // So-vremennye tehnologii i nauchno-tehnicheskiy progress. – 2023. – №. 1. – S. 95-96.

2. Aleksandrova E. G. Mesto testirovaniya v razlichnyh modelyah raz-rabotki programmnogo obespecheniya / E. G. Aleksandrova, N. N. Dobrynina. – Tekst : neposredstvennyy // Sovremennye tehnologii i nauchno-tehnicheskiy progress. – 2023. – №. 1. – S. 97-98.

Login or Create
* Forgot password?